Bones of the Upper Limb: Radius

The radius is longer of the two bones that make up the human antebrachium or forearm. At the proximal end, the radius articulates with the capitulum of the humerus and the radial notch of the ulna to form the elbow joint. At the distal end, the radius articulates with the ulna via the ulnar notch, forming the distal radioulnar joint. Distally, the radius also attaches to the carpal wrist bones (scaphoid and lunate) to form the radiocarpal joint.

Ankle Joint

The ankle is formed by the talocrural joint (crural = leg). It consists of the articulations between the talus bone of the foot and the distal ends of the tibia and fibula of the leg. The superior aspect of the talus bone is square-shaped and has three areas of articulation. The top of the talus articulates with the inferior tibia. Hand-based thumb spica casting.

W O Roberts1

  • 1MinnHealth SportsCare, White Bear Lake, MN, 55110, USA.

The Physician and Sportsmedicine
|January 21, 2010
PubMed
Summary
This summary is machine-generated.

A thumb spica cast protects thumb joints after UCL sprains, allowing wrist movement and grip for daily activities. This hand-based cast immobilizes metacarpophalangeal and interphalangeal joints for effective healing.

Area of Science:

  • Orthopedic surgery
  • Sports medicine
  • Hand surgery

Background:

  • Ulnar collateral ligament (UCL) sprains are common thumb injuries.
  • Effective immobilization is crucial for healing UCL injuries.
  • Current treatment options may limit hand function.

Purpose of the Study:

  • To evaluate the utility of a hand-based thumb spica cast.
  • To assess the cast's effectiveness in protecting thumb joints.
  • To determine if the cast allows functional hand use.

Main Methods:

  • Application of a hand-based thumb spica cast.
  • Immobilization of the metacarpophalangeal (MCP) and interphalangeal (IP) thumb joints.
  • Assessment of thumb joint protection and functional hand use.

Main Results:

  • The thumb spica cast effectively protected the MCP and IP joints.
  • Patients could grip implements and move the wrist joint.
  • Immobilization of the thumb joints was achieved.

Conclusions:

  • A hand-based thumb spica cast is a viable option for uncomplicated UCL thumb sprains.
  • This casting technique allows for continued participation in activities.
  • It provides joint protection while maintaining some hand function.
